Engineering Manager (Service Product Design Authority)

Location: Remote (UK) + Quarterly International Travel
Salary: Up to £80k + Package A Global Engineering Leader in Advanced Electromechanical Process Systems is looking to appoint an Engineering Manager to act as the design authority for service‑engineered products. Their systems support high‑tech manufacturing across the world and the service division plays a vital part in keeping equipment safe, compliant and reliable. If you're an Engineering Manager who likes to get stuck in, make decisive technical calls and see the impact of your work across a global installed base, this is a role that will keep you fully engaged. As Engineering Manager, you'll act as the technical authority for a portfolio of complex service products used across advanced manufacturing. It's upgrade development, lifecycle engineering and full design ownership. If you like steering the engineering direction rather than waiting for someone else to make the call, this is your environment. This isn't the sort of role where you sit back and issue instructions. You'll be right in the middle of engineering reviews, approving design decisions, shaping delivery plans and making sure every solution released into the field is solid, compliant and ready for real‑world use. The work is genuinely varied which means one moment you're deep in mechanical analysis, the next you're resolving an electrical or systems challenge that needs a clear decision. You'll take high‑level roadmap ideas and turn them into structured engineering projects that can actually be delivered. Scoping, prioritising, balancing workloads and keeping momentum when things shift will all sit under your ownership. If you like an environment that rewards quick thinking backed by proper engineering judgement, you'll do well here. Reliability and root cause work is a core part of the role. You'll use methods such as FMEA and 8D to stay ahead of issues, cut warranty noise and improve how equipment performs over its lifecycle. Data will back up your decisions. This is real engineering, not box ticking. The global element is what makes it unique. You'll be working with teams across Europe, Asia and the US while staying closely connected to the UK engineering hubs in Bristol and Burgess Hill. You'll help raise standards, support development, build good engineering habits and drive a culture where accountability is taken seriously. What you'll need to bring
1. An Engineering deg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Industrial or a related discipline
2. Strong engineering background in mechatronics, electromechanical systems, mechanical AND electrical / control software or systems engineering
3. Experience of Service Products for compliance-heavy, safety-focused industries such as semiconductor equipment, chemical process machinery, wet-process systems, industrial automation, pharmaceuticals, aerospace, or similar
4. Around 10 years of engineering experience with at least 5 years in leadership or technical authority roles
5. Experience acting as a design authority in a regulated or safety‑focused environment
6. Proven delivery of product upgrades or complex service product developments
7. Experience working across multi‑platform engineering involving hardware and software
8. Clear understanding of compliance frameworks such as CE Marking, ISO, RoHS, REACH or SEMI standards
9. Strong grounding in engineering change control, versioning and retrofit processes
10. Competence with FMEA, 8D and reliability tools including Weibull analysis
11. Confident decision making using first‑principles thinking
12. Good capability with data tools such as MATLAB, Minitab or Excel modelling
13. A collaborative approach that works well across cultures and time zones
14. Strong communication skills with the ability to simplify complex engineering topics
Travel will include quarterly visits to Europe, China, Japan and South Korea alongside UK travel to Bristol and Burgess Hill.
